private void myMDIForm_Load(object sender, EventArgs e) { for (int i = 0; i < 5; i++) { HamburgerMenu hmenu = new HamburgerMenu(); ExtraMalzemeMenu emenu = new ExtraMalzemeMenu(); hmenu.MenuAdi = standartmenuler[i * 2]; hmenu.MenuFiyati = Convert.ToDecimal(standartmenuler[(i * 2) + 1]); emenu.ExtraMazlzemeAdi = standartextralar[i * 2]; emenu.ExtraMalzemeFiyati = Convert.ToDecimal(standartextralar[(i * 2) + 1]); rMenuEkle(hmenu); rExtraMalzemeEkle(emenu); } }
private void btnKaydet_Click(object sender, EventArgs e) { try { ExtraMalzemeMenu malzeme = new ExtraMalzemeMenu(); malzeme.ExtraMazlzemeAdi = tbExtraMalzemeAdi.Text; malzeme.ExtraMalzemeFiyati = nUDMalzemeFiyati.Value; ((myMDIForm)MdiParent).rExtraMalzemeEkle(malzeme); this.Close(); } catch (Exception ex) { MessageBox.Show(ex.Message); } }
public void SiparisEkle() { if (!rbBuyuk.Checked && !rbOrta.Checked && !rbKucuk.Checked) { MessageBox.Show("Lütfen boyut seçin"); } else { string extralar = ""; Siparis siparis = new Siparis(); siparis.sMenuAdi = cbMenü.Text; siparis.sMenuFiyati = Convert.ToDecimal(cbMenü.SelectedValue); foreach (CheckBox item in flpExtraMalzeme.Controls) { if (item.Checked) { ExtraMalzemeMenu a = new ExtraMalzemeMenu(); a.ExtraMazlzemeAdi = item.Text; a.ExtraMalzemeFiyati = Convert.ToDecimal(item.Tag); siparis.sExtraEkle(a); extralar += " " + item.Text; } } foreach (RadioButton item in gbBoyut.Controls) { if (item.Checked) { siparis.Boyut = item.Text; } } siparis.siparisNo = Guid.NewGuid(); siparis.Adet = Convert.ToInt16(nUDMenuAdedi.Value); siparis.Toplam = Hesapla(); lbSiparis.Items.Add($"{ siparis.sMenuAdi} Menüsünden {siparis.Adet} Adet {siparis.Boyut} Boy Extralar => {extralar} TOPLAM TUTAR {siparis.Toplam}-TL"); lbSiparis.ValueMember = siparis.siparisNo.ToString(); onSiparislerim.Add(siparis); } //cbMenü.SelectedIndex = -1; rbBuyuk.Checked = false; rbOrta.Checked = false; rbKucuk.Checked = false; foreach (CheckBox item in flpExtraMalzeme.Controls) { item.Checked = false; } nUDMenuAdedi.Value = 1; Hesapla(); }
public void rExtraMalzemeEkle(ExtraMalzemeMenu a) { rExtraMalzemeMenu.Add(a); }
public void sExtraEkle(ExtraMalzemeMenu a) { sExrta.Add(a); }